In 1766, Esther Forbes Whitney entered the world in Brookfield, Worcester Co., MA, USA, born to Nathaniel Whitney And Abigail Masters. Esther Forbes Whitney married Luther Scott, and had children including Eleazer Scott, Elihu Scott, Elisha J Scott, Luther Scott, Lydia Scott, Nathan Whitney Scott, Royal Scott, Stephen Scott. Esther Forbes Whitney passed away in 1849 in Baker Cemetery, Greensboro, Orleans, VT, USA.
